Diagnoza Narrow umbilicus covering about one third of mature conch diameter, smooth surface. Porównanie As discussed above, Czarnocki introduced this species in replacement of Clymenia humboldti sensu Gürich, 1896 but I believe that his choice of holotype from Ostrówka changed the original meaning of the species and made his Flexiclymenia puschi a distinct species. In having a simple septum and relatively wide venter, it resembles some species of Platyclymenia and may be considered its earliest member, with some affinities to Cyrtoclymenia. Perhaps also the single specimen from the upper Platyclymenia beds at Ostrówka, on which P. laxata Czarnocki, 1989 is based, belongs also to this species. Autekologia Występowanie geograficzne Jabłonna and Ostrówka. Zasięg czasowy Early P. trachytera Zone. Materiały muzealne ZPAL: 4 specimens. Literatura Dzik, J. 2006.
